## Deep-Link Routing Env Vars

Heads up, future maintainer: the Larkspur app's deep-link router reads everything from the env at boot, not at build time. `LINK_SCHEME` controls the custom URL scheme, `LINK_FALLBACK_URL` is where unmatched links land, and `LINK_ROUTE_TABLE` points at the JSON route map. Don't hardcode routes in the client — marketing changes them constantly. Universal links also need `LINK_DOMAIN_ALLOWLIST` set or iOS silently drops them. For verifying signed link payloads, the router needs its signing secret on the next line.

sealed setting: ARCHIVE_KEY3=8d0

Handover note — Crumbwheel order cutoffs.

Welcome aboard. The bakery cutoff rule in Crumbwheel closes same-day orders at 14:00 local to each storefront, not UTC — this has bitten us twice. Holiday overrides live in the calendar service and take precedence silently, so always check there first when a cutoff looks wrong. To unlock the calendar service's admin console after a restart, enter the recovery passphrase below.

vault phrase of bagap-bahaf = silion-pelox-sorox-casdor-quenwyn-fraax-eliox-praael-kelion-quenvan-kasox-rusael-norius-belvan

## Webhook Retry Semantics (Environments)

The Quillhaven platform retries failed webhook deliveries with exponential backoff in every environment, but staging caps attempts lower than production. Plugin authors should treat deliveries as at-least-once and deduplicate by event ID. A 2xx response stops retries; anything else schedules the next attempt. Each environment's dispatcher starts with the following configuration values.

config for bahop-fajep:
DRUATH_PIN=4501
DRUATH_TENANT=briwyn
DRUATH_METRICS_HOST=metrics.druath.brasksoft.test
DRUATH_SEAL=seal_7d2e069d
DRUATH_STANDBY_TEAM=olieth

Ticket: Missed pick-up — notarised deed

The courier scheduled to collect the notarised deed for the Fenhallow property transfer did not arrive yesterday afternoon. The deed remains in the records safe, sealed and witnessed. A new collection is booked for tomorrow at 10:00. Please ensure the courier receives the confidential hand-over instruction stated below.

handover note for fahof-yagug: the gordor lamath courier leaves the zorath oliael gileth ledger at gate 6225 under passcode 056860